From mycarcheck.com data, this model has been checked 186 times, with 156 distinct VINs, indicating steady interest in used vehicle checks. The average valuation from private sales sits around £1,300, reflecting its affordability in the second-hand market. The typical mileage recorded is about 135,000 miles, with owners averaging around four to five previous keepers, suggesting moderate use and good longevity for a vehicle of its age.
